1. What Makes Tourism So Vital to Thailand’s Economy?
Tourism is vital to Thailand’s economy, generating substantial revenue, creating numerous jobs, and stimulating growth across various sectors. The Tourism Authority of Thailand reports that tourism contributes approximately 12% to the country’s GDP. This income is crucial for funding infrastructure projects, improving public services, and supporting local businesses.
1.1. Direct Financial Contributions
Tourists spend money on accommodations, food, transportation, and activities, which directly boosts the income of local businesses and the government. This financial influx supports the livelihoods of countless individuals and families.
1.2. Job Creation
The tourism industry is a significant employer in Thailand, offering jobs in hotels, restaurants, tour operations, and transportation services. According to research from the Thailand Development Research Institute (TDRI) in 2022, tourism supports over 8 million jobs.
1.3. Stimulating Related Industries
Tourism stimulates growth in related industries such as agriculture, manufacturing, and transportation. Hotels and restaurants source food from local farms, while souvenirs and handicrafts are produced by local artisans. This creates a ripple effect that benefits the entire economy.
2. How Does Tourism Support the Preservation of Thai Culture?
Tourism supports the preservation of Thai culture by providing incentives to maintain historical sites, promote traditional arts, and celebrate local customs. It fosters cultural pride and encourages the transmission of cultural heritage to future generations.
2.1. Funding for Historical Sites
Revenue from tourism helps fund the restoration and maintenance of historical sites and temples. These sites are crucial to Thailand’s cultural identity and attract visitors from around the world. For example, the ancient city of Ayutthaya receives significant funding from tourism revenue, which is essential for its preservation.
2.2. Promotion of Traditional Arts and Crafts
Tourism creates a market for traditional Thai arts and crafts, encouraging artisans to continue their work and pass on their skills. The demand for handmade souvenirs and artwork supports local artisans and helps preserve traditional techniques.
2.3. Cultural Exchange and Understanding
Tourism promotes cultural exchange and understanding between visitors and locals. This interaction fosters appreciation for Thai culture and helps preserve its unique traditions and customs.

6. What Are Some of the Negative Impacts of Tourism in Thailand and How Can They Be Mitigated?
While tourism brings many benefits to Thailand, it also has some negative impacts, including environmental degradation, cultural commodification, and economic disparities. These impacts can be mitigated through sustainable tourism practices, responsible management, and community involvement.
6.1. Environmental Degradation
Mass tourism can lead to environmental degradation, including pollution, deforestation, and damage to natural ecosystems. To mitigate these impacts, it is important to promote sustainable tourism practices such as reducing waste, conserving energy, and protecting natural resources.
6.2. Cultural Commodification
Tourism can lead to the commodification of culture, where traditional practices and customs are turned into tourist attractions. This can undermine the authenticity and integrity of local culture. To mitigate this, it is important to involve local communities in tourism planning and management, and to promote cultural awareness and respect among tourists.
6.3. Economic Disparities
Tourism can exacerbate economic disparities, with some communities benefiting more than others. To address this, it is important to ensure that tourism revenue is distributed equitably and that local residents have access to economic opportunities.

8. What Are Some of Thailand’s Most Popular Tourist Destinations?
Thailand boasts a variety of popular tourist destinations, each offering unique experiences and attractions. These include bustling cities, serene beaches, historical sites, and lush natural landscapes.
8.1. Bangkok
The capital city of Thailand, Bangkok, is famous for its vibrant street life, ornate temples, bustling markets, and modern skyscrapers. Key attractions include the Grand Palace, Wat Arun (Temple of Dawn), and Chatuchak Weekend Market.
8.2. Phuket
Phuket, Thailand’s largest island, is renowned for its stunning beaches, crystal-clear waters, and lively nightlife. Popular spots include Patong Beach, Phi Phi Islands, and Phang Nga Bay.
8.3. Chiang Mai
Located in northern Thailand, Chiang Mai offers a more relaxed atmosphere with ancient temples, lush mountains, and elephant sanctuaries. Key attractions include Doi Suthep Temple, the Old City, and ethical elephant encounters.
8.4. Ayutthaya
The former capital of Thailand, Ayutthaya, is a UNESCO World Heritage site featuring impressive ruins of temples and palaces. It provides a glimpse into Thailand’s rich history and cultural heritage.
9. How Has the COVID-19 Pandemic Impacted Tourism in Thailand?
The COVID-19 pandemic has had a significant impact on tourism in Thailand, with travel restrictions and lockdowns leading to a sharp decline in visitor numbers. The tourism industry has been forced to adapt to the new normal by implementing safety measures, promoting domestic tourism, and exploring new markets.
9.1. Decline in Tourist Arrivals
The pandemic resulted in a drastic decline in tourist arrivals to Thailand, with international borders closed and travel restrictions in place. This had a significant impact on the economy, particularly in areas heavily reliant on tourism.
9.2. Adaptation and Innovation
The tourism industry has adapted to the pandemic by implementing safety measures such as enhanced cleaning protocols, social distancing, and mask-wearing requirements. Many businesses have also innovated by offering new products and services, such as virtual tours and staycation packages.
9.3. Focus on Domestic Tourism
With international travel limited, Thailand has focused on promoting domestic tourism to help support the industry. The government has launched campaigns to encourage locals to explore their own country and support local businesses.

12. What Unique Cultural Experiences Can Tourists Enjoy in Thailand?
Tourists can enjoy a wealth of unique cultural experiences in Thailand, from visiting ancient temples to participating in traditional festivals and learning about local crafts. These experiences offer insights into Thailand’s rich history, vibrant culture, and warm hospitality.
12.1. Visiting Ancient Temples
Thailand is home to thousands of ancient temples, each with its own unique architecture, history, and significance. Visiting these temples is a must for anyone interested in learning about Thai culture and religion.
12.2. Participating in Traditional Festivals
Thailand hosts a variety of traditional festivals throughout the year, offering tourists the opportunity to experience local customs and celebrations firsthand. These festivals include Songkran (Thai New Year), Loy Krathong (Festival of Lights), and Yi Peng (Lantern Festival).
12.3. Learning About Local Crafts
Thailand is known for its skilled artisans who produce a variety of beautiful handicrafts, including silk textiles, wood carvings, and pottery. Tourists can visit local workshops and learn about these crafts, or even try their hand at making their own souvenirs.

14. What Travel Tips Should First-Time Visitors to Thailand Keep in Mind?
First-time visitors to Thailand should keep a few essential travel tips in mind to ensure a smooth and enjoyable trip. These tips include being aware of local customs, packing appropriately, and staying hydrated.
14.1. Be Aware of Local Customs
It is important to be aware of local customs and traditions when visiting Thailand, such as removing your shoes before entering a temple and avoiding pointing your feet at anyone. This shows respect for the local culture and helps avoid misunderstandings.
14.2. Pack Appropriately
Pack light, breathable clothing suitable for the tropical climate, as well as comfortable shoes for walking and exploring. Don’t forget essentials like sunscreen, insect repellent, and a hat to protect yourself from the sun.
14.3. Stay Hydrated
The tropical climate in Thailand can be dehydrating, so it is important to drink plenty of water throughout the day. Carry a water bottle with you and refill it whenever possible.
